#ifndef QHDMI_CEC_H |
|
#define QHDMI_CEC_H |
|
|
|
#include <hardware/hdmi_cec.h> |
|
#include <utils/RefBase.h> |
|
|
|
namespace qClient { |
|
class QHDMIClient; |
|
}; |
|
|
|
namespace qhdmicec { |
|
|
|
#define SYSFS_BASE "/sys/class/graphics/fb" |
|
#define MAX_PATH_LENGTH 128 |
|
|
|
struct cec_callback_t { |
|
// Function in HDMI service to call back on CEC messages |
|
event_callback_t callback_func; |
|
// This stores the object to pass back to the framework |
|
void* callback_arg; |
|
|
|
}; |
|
|
|
struct cec_context_t { |
|
hdmi_cec_device_t device; // Device for HW module |
|
cec_callback_t callback; // Struct storing callback object |
|
bool enabled; |
|
bool arc_enabled; |
|
bool system_control; // If true, HAL/driver handle CEC messages |
|
int fb_num; // Framebuffer node for HDMI |
|
char fb_sysfs_path[MAX_PATH_LENGTH]; |
|
hdmi_port_info *port_info; // HDMI port info |
|
|
|
// Logical address is stored in an array, the index of the array is the |
|
// logical address and the value in the index shows whether it is set or not |
|
int logical_address[CEC_ADDR_BROADCAST]; |
|
int version; |
|
uint32_t vendor_id; |
|
android::sp<qClient::QHDMIClient> disp_client; |
|
}; |
|
|
|
void cec_receive_message(cec_context_t *ctx, char *msg, ssize_t len); |
|
void cec_hdmi_hotplug(cec_context_t *ctx, int connected); |
|
|
|
}; //namespace |
|
#endif /* end of include guard: QHDMI_CEC_H */
